I’m fairly certain that checking “Enable AUR Support” does not suffice.

A precondition to using it is to have the package group base-devel installed.
All the programs in it.
It contains all the programs needed for building AUR packages - fakeroot among them.

pamac can build this including buildling the dependencies from AUR.

The recipe is quite simple

sudo pacman-mirrors -aS unstable
sudo pacman -Syu git base-devel --needed
pamac build ape
